According to the figures released by ABC, Independent has emerged as the fastest growing national newspaper website in December and the only site to record a month-on-month increase in traffic.

?The Independent which had relaunched its website at the start of November saw a rise in its global audience by 16.5 per cent to 15.8m unique browsers. Mail Online continued to retain the top slot with 84.1m unique browsers, a slight month-on-month dip due to the holiday month of December.

According to Comscore, Mail Online is now the most popular newspaper website in the world and has overtaken the New York Times. Their figures gave it 45.3m online readers in December.

UK national newspaper website figures December 2012 (source ABC)

Daily figures:

(Name of site; average daily unique browsers; percentage change year on year; month on month)


Mail Online : 4,838,140 ; 58.89 ; -5.03
guardian.co.uk : 2,937,070 ; 31.45 ; -20.61
Telegraph : 2,156,001 ; 36.17 ; -8.16
The Independent : 758,524 ; 50.35 ; 10.56
Mirror Group Digital : 726,653 ; 44.19 ; -4.23

Small businesses embrace online advertising in UK
16/05/2012

Online advertising and social networks have overtaken local directories such as Yellow Pages in the UK as the main way small businesses seek out new customers.

Consumers in the UK support online advertising
14/05/2012

A poll conducted jointly by IAB, the trade body, ValueClick, the advertising company, and Kantar Media, the research firm, shows that consumers in the UK are mostly supportive of online advertising, with a majority recognising its importance to supporting free websites and content.


UK online advertising registers a record high
09/05/2012

A report from the Internet Advertising Bureau UK (IAB), conducted by PricewaterhouseCoopers shows that online advertising and mobile advertising spend in Britain reached almost 5 billion pounds last year, backed by an impressive increase in video ads and marketing on social media platforms.
